Title: Innovations by Matthew R Selmon: A Pioneer in Vascular Catheter Systems

Introduction

Matthew R Selmon, based in Atherton, California, is a distinguished inventor known for his substantial contributions to the field of medical devices, specifically vascular catheter systems. With an impressive portfolio of 23 patents, Selmon has made significant strides in improving the treatment of vascular occlusions, thereby enhancing patient outcomes in interventional procedures.

Latest Patents

Among Selmon's latest innovations is a catheter system designed for vascular re-entry from a sub-intimal space. This advanced system allows for effective access to the true lumen of blood vessels from the sub-intimal plane, incorporating visualization elements to determine orientation and securing tissue at the entry site to reduce catheter movement. Additionally, Selmon has developed methods and apparatus for treating vascular occlusions, which utilize movable tissue displacement elements to create pathways for guidewires or interventional devices. These designs aim to facilitate better access and treatment for patients with chronic total occlusions.
